Frank's RedHot Buffalo Chicken Dip Recipe

Ingredients:

2 cups shredded cooked chicken
1 eight-ounce pkg. cream cheese softened
1/2 cup Frank's RedHot Original Cayenne Pepper Sauce or Franks' Red Hot Buffalo Wings Sauce
1/2 cup blue cheese or ranch dressing
1/2 cup crumbled bleu cheese or your favorite shredded cheese

Directions:

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
Combine all ingredients and spoon into shallow 1 quart baking dish

Bake 20 minutes or until mixture is heated through. Stir. Garnish with chopped green onions if desired. Serve with crackers and/or vegetables.

Number Of Servings:

4 cups dip
Preparation Time:

5 time prep and 20 min cooking time
